Repossessed cars were pulled out by the credit companies, lending groups or bank from its previous owner. The most common reason is failure to comply with the payment terms or issuance of bouncing checks. Another reason may be because the buyer cannot afford to pay for the car anymore. The end result is that the bank or credit company repossess the car. There are also some cars that had been impounded by the police because they were used for illegal purposes.
